一、驅動器接線
1.1驅動器接口:
驅動器接線,需要連接兩個接口,一個是反饋接口,一個是STO接口。
反饋接口,我這里使用了elmo驅動器的Port A。這個接口提供5v電源。並且可以輸入旋轉編碼器和霍爾傳感器。接口定義如下。其中2口為GND。
圖1 Port A接口定義
STO接口的1、2兩個口接5V或24V,我接了24V。3口接GND。
圖2 STO接口定義
1.2電機接口
電機型號為maxton 470469
電機線:Motor winding 1/2/3對應
編碼器線:
圖3電機線上1-9根,從左到右分別為圖4編碼器接口定義的2-10。
圖3電機線上10-14根,從左到右分別為圖5霍爾傳感器定義的1-5。
根據電機線定義和Elmo接口重新接線。
圖3 電機線
圖4 編碼器接口定義
圖5 霍爾傳感器接口定義
二、驅動器配置 EAS II
這里使用的EAS II驅動器安裝包為Elmo+Application+Studio+II+Setup+2.3.1.4.exe。
官網下載比較復雜,這里提供一個百度雲盤下載地址:鏈接: https://pan.baidu.com/s/1nwJMQiX 密碼: fjvf
2.1驅動器連接
第一步,驅動器接線完成后,接通elmo的24V電源,將elmo通過mini-usb連接到電腦usb口,自動搜索安裝串口驅動。若失敗,可通過備份的驅動添加。
備份驅動下載地址:鏈接: https://pan.baidu.com/s/1b_goLhu_GmLBm4kK9aanUw 密碼: j8jq
驅動安裝完成后,使用EAS II連接驅動器。按照圖片中的指示操作。
第二步:添加驅動器到工作空間。在工作空間右鍵,選擇Add Gold Driver。
新建驅動器(Driver03)如圖所示,前面兩個為之前新建過的。
第三步:在Driver03里,選擇目標連接方式,選擇Direct Access USB(直接使用USB)連接。
第四步:選擇USB連接的端口。選擇第一步在設備管理器里的端口,這里選擇com3接口。
第五步:連接驅動器。在右側系統設置的工作區里,郵件Driver03,選擇connect。
Driver03左側綠色則表示連接成功,同時可以在右側看到驅動器型號信息。
2.2電機配置
電機參數如下
減速箱參數:
電機參數:
編碼器參數:
電機連接成功后,進入Driver Setup and Motion界面。配置驅動器參數。
第一步:進入Quick Tuning
第二步:配置電機參數。配置之后記得apply。根據圖片中的內容填入,在這里,Peak Current應大於等於Continuous Stall Current。Continuous Stall Current這個具體的中文意思我翻譯的有問題。
第三步:配置反饋參數,具體參考圖片。
Lines/revolution是編碼器旋轉一周線數。Counts/revolution是旋轉一周計數,包括a/b兩個通道的上升沿和下降沿。Gitch Filter是最大轉速時每秒鍾計數,包括a/b兩個通道的上升沿和下降沿。
第四步:進行自動調試。自動調試時電機會轉動,這里我測試到的電機小幅度移動是因為減速箱減速比大,而我只觀察了經過減速的電機轉軸,電機的實際轉動超過一圈。
配置成功后如下圖所示。
2.3(可選)電機測試
配置成功后可在EAS里直接控制電機轉動,進行測試。
鏈接: https://pan.baidu.com/s/1b_goLhu_GmLBm4kK9aanUw 密碼: j8jq